raise Error('The casa commands log is not executable!') # # This file contains CASA commands run by the pipeline. Although all # commands required to calibrate the data are included here, this file cannot # be executed, nor does it contain heuristic and flagging calculations # performed by pipeline code. This file is useful to understand which CASA # commands are being run by each pipeline task. If one wishes to re-run the # pipeline, one should use the pipeline script linked on the front page or By # Task page of the weblog.
